
在实际业务中,用户用TP钱包(Token Pocket)向合约地址充值并非简单的转账操作,而涉及合约接口、事件监听、以及跨链与合约内资金隔离的设计。下面以教程式步骤说明如何安全、便捷地完成充值,并探讨链间通信、支付隔离与全球化趋势。
步骤一:前期准备。确认合约地址、链ID与ABI,检查合约是否支持接收该资产(ERC-20/Token标准或接受原生币)。在TP钱包中加载合约信息,准备好gas和代币授权(approve)。
步骤二:执行充值。若为https://www.saircloud.com ,ERC-20,先在钱包完成approve,再调用合约的收款方法;若为原生币,直接发起to合约的交易并填入value。务必估算gas并设置适当的nonce,防止重放或失败。
步骤三:监听与对账。通过节点或事件索引服务监听TransactionReceipt与合约事件,确认充值成功后在后端做入账记录、触发业务逻辑与告警。

支付隔离与安全实践:将不同来源资金隔离到独立子合约或托管账户,使用多签或时间锁控制大额提款,避免将用户充值直接混入业务资金池。同时在合约层面加入重入保护、输入校验与提现限额。
链间通信与互操作:跨链充值通常借助桥(bridge)、跨链消息协议或中继器(relayer)将资产或证明传递到目标链。设计时要考虑最终性验证、观测者节点分布与中继者经济激励,优先使用受审计的跨链协议(如带有Merkle证明或CCIP/Wormhole类方案)。
便捷支付操作与用户体验:可采用meta-transaction或Gas Station Network实现免Gas或代付体验;在钱包端提供一键授权、手续费估算与失败回滚提示,降低用户误操作概率。
全球化趋势与技术演进:随着稳定币、跨链标准和零知识证明普及,跨境支付将更高效合规。企业需关注法规合规(KYC/AML)与隐私保护,并拥抱Layer2、zk-rollup等提升吞吐的技术。
专家洞察:风险管理比功能更重要。建议在上线前进行完整审计、部署监控与应急预案,并设计可升级的合约逻辑以应对未来跨链协议演进。
按此流程操作,可以在保证安全与合规的前提下,为用户提供便捷、全球化的合约充值体验。
评论
小明
教程很实用,特别是支付隔离那部分,受益匪浅。
CryptoCat
关于跨链的风险点能否再展开讲讲桥的经济激励?
链上行者
建议加上meta-transaction的具体实现示例,会更好落地。
Luna旅人
对全球化合规的提醒很到位,企业应该早做准备。